So where are we now? Recently, the optical sector has gotten slammed based in my view mainly on sentiment, institutional profit taking, and disputed rumors from a well-known research firm on delays to next-gen architecture. Photonics Is Next is down 29.6% in the last month and 16.8% in just the last week.
That's why I think it's the perfect time to re-balance, add more weight to higher conviction positions, and add one brand new position I missed earlier on.
This rebalance today adds Corning ($GLW) as a new 10.00% position. Down 13% in five days. Now anchored by three hyperscale relationships (a 10x-capacity NVIDIA partnership, a Meta deal worth up to $6B, and a multi billion dollar Amazon agreement).
Three names get boosted: AAOI (12.30%→15.00%), LITE (14.75%→15.00%), and AEHR (4.26%→5.00%).
Six positions are trimmed: TSEM (11.11%→10.00%), COHR (16.07%→15.00%), AXTI (8.58%→5.00%), CIEN (11.39%→10.00%), MRVL (11.11%→5.00%), and VIAV (10.43%→10.00%).
For catalysts that could create upside, I'm watching:
- Hyperscale Capex Guides In Upcoming Earnings
- Earnings From All Optical Names In The Basket Particularly $COHR $LITE $AAOI
- The launch of mainstream optical ETFs $LAZR and $LYTE
